#c6555e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c6555e is composed of 77.6% red, 33.3%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 57.1% magenta, 52.5%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 355.2 degrees, a saturation of 49.8% and a lightness of 55.5%. #c6555e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ffaabc with #8d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#c6555e color description : Moderate red.

#c6555e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#c6555e has RGB values of R:198, G:85, B:94 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.53,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 12997982.

Shades and Tints of #c6555e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060202 is the darkest color, while #fcf7f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c6555e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#92898a is the less saturated color, while #fa2132 is the most saturated one.
